  • The Ethiopia refugee agency and UNHCR are registering over 400 new South Sudanese refugee arrivals at Okugo Refugee Camp in Gambella region. The new arrivals entered Ethiopia through Raad entry point following intra-ethnic conflict in Pochalla, South Sudan. New arrivals continue. The intra-ethnic fighting reportedly broke out on 21 March in Pochalla town between Pochalla North and Pochalla South Anuak community and the fighting spread to nearby towns.

  • The first pilot biometric food distribution system was successfully completed within 8.5 days in Jewi Refugee Camp. From the total targeted population of 48,639 persons, 37,403 persons were able to collect food ration using the Biometrics system showing a 23% no show rate. Additional tests will be undertaken in the coming two months to draw a clear trend within which the construction of the two biometrics food centres in Jewi camp would have been completed.
